API Standard Thread Connections for Oil Casing
The American Petroleum Institute (API) has established standards for various aspects of the oil and gas industry, including specifications for thread connections used in oil casing. The API standard for thread connections for oil casing is known as API Spec 5B. Commonly used API-certified threaded connections include the Short Round Thread (STC), Long Round Thread (LTC), and Buttress Thread (BTC).

Introduction To ASTM A178 ERW Steel Pipe
ASTM A178 is a specification that covers electric-resistance-welded (ERW) carbon steel and carbon manganese steel boiler and superheater tubes.
